Given f(x)= 4x squared - 3x + 2 and g(x)= 3x - 2, find each of the following. simplify the expression if possible.
a. f(-5)
b. f(x+h) - f(x)/ h
c. (f o g)(x)

a) f(-5) = 4 * (-5)^2 - 3*(-5) + 2 ( replacing x by -5)
= 100 + 15 +2
= 117.
